Description:

IC UNIV BUS TXRX 18BIT 56TSSOP

Products specifications
  • Mount
    Surface Mount
  • Mounting Type
    Surface Mount
  • Package / Case
    56-TFSOP (0.240, 6.10mm Width)
  • Number of Pins
    56
  • Supplier Device Package
    56-TSSOP
  • Number of Elements
    1
  • Operating Temperature

    -40°C~85°C
  • Packaging

    Tube
  • Series
    74GTLP
  • Published
    2002
  • Part Status

    Obsolete
  • Moisture Sensitivity Level (MSL)
    1 (Unlimited)
  • Max Operating Temperature

    85°C
  • Min Operating Temperature
    -40°C
  • Voltage - Supply
    3.15V~3.45V
  • Base Part Number
    74GTLP18T612
  • Operating Supply Voltage

    3.3V
  • Polarity
    Non-Inverting
  • Number of Channels
    18
  • Number of Circuits
    18-Bit
  • Max Supply Voltage
